Location of VDR in human skeletal muscle after 16 weeks of 4,000 IU/day vitamin D3 supplementation. The vitamin D3 supplemented group (n = 9) increased skeletal muscle plasma membrane VDR protein by 1.42 % (±1.21) while the placebo group (n = 11) decreased by −6.7 % (±5.26) (P = 0.2) as demonstrated by immunohistochemistry and determined by Student’s t test. Statistical significance between groups, *P ≤ 0.05
